The Effects of Surgical Positioning on Arthroscopic Shoulder Stabilization: A Prospective Comparison

简要总结
The purpose of this study is to prospectively determine whether intra-operative factors, complications and post-operative outcomes differ between beach chair and lateral decubitus surgical positioning for patients receiving arthroscopic shoulder stabilization (anterior or posterior) due to shoulder instability.

入选标准
- •Any patient undergoing arthroscopic labral repair due to shoulder instability, with or without concomitant debridement.
排除标准
- •Revision stabilization surgery
- •No previous Bankart repairs, labral repairs, capsulorrhaphy, or Latarjet
- •Multidirectional shoulder instability
- •Concomitant rotator cuff repair, biceps tenodesis/tenotomy, HAGL repair
- •Isolated SLAP repair/labral repair in association with mechanism other than -instability (eg: overhead athletes) open procedures for instability
